To address this task, this article proposes methods for identifying critical imports and constructing a statistical model to assess the degree of dependence between these variables. The study hypothesizes that a statistically significant relationship exists between regional critical imports and indicators of regional economic dynamics under external constraints. The research methodology is based on systematization, grouping, and panel data regression modelling with robust cluster standard errors. The empirical base includes statistical data for regions of the Volga Federal Okrug for 2011–2021. The sample comprises import volumes for 103 Commodity Nomenclature of Foreign Economic Activity (TN VED) codes. The findings reveal the key components that form the conceptual framework for determining critical imports: the role of imports in generating regional value added; the share of imports originating from unfriendly countries; and the classification of imports as final or intermediate goods. The relationship between critical imports and the gross regional product (GRP) of the regions under study is subsequently analysed. The estimated elasticity coefficient for the variable “Volume of critical imports” in the model, controlling for education level, investment, and consumer expenditure, is 0.0326. This relationship is moderate compared to other explanatory variables. A limitation of the study is its reliance on official statistical data, which has been inconsistently published for Russian regional imports since 2022.</p></abstract><abstract xml:lang="ru"><p>В условиях усиливающихся санкционных рестрикций внешнего порядка крайне важной задачей становится исследование взаимосвязей между логистическими разрывами в поставках импорта и перспективами экономического развития. Решению этой задачи и посвящена настоящая статья, целью которой является разработка методических подходов к идентификации критического импорта и разработка на этой основе экономико-статистической модели, определяющей степень его воздействия на перспективы экономического роста. В качестве гипотезы принимается допущение о наличии коррелированности между критическим импортом регионов и параметрами их экономической динамики в условиях внешних ограничений. Основу исследования составляют методы систематизации, группировки и регрессионного моделирования панельных данных с учетом робастных кластерных стандартных ошибок. В качестве исходных данных использованы актуальные статистические материалы субъектов Приволжского федерального округа за 2011–2021 гг. В выборку вошли данные об объемах импорта по 103 товарным номенклатурам внешнеэкономической деятельности (ТН ВЭД). По результатам проведенного исследования выделены главные компоненты, определяющие содержательную среду и концептуальную основу для идентификации критического импорта (участие импорта в создании добавленной стоимости региона, доля ввозимой продукции из недружественных стран, принадлежность импорта к категории товаров конечного / промежуточного потребления), реализован анализ его взаимосвязи с ВРП исследуемой региональной группы. Установлено, что значение коэффициента эластичности в конструируемой модели при переменной «Объем критического импорта», куда наряду с данным фактором вошли и иные контрольные переменные (уровень образования, инвестиции и потребительские расходы), достигает уровня 0,0326. Выявленная статистическая связь носит умеренный характер на фоне других анализируемых параметров, вошедших в построенную модель. Ограничением исследования является зависимость от статистических данных, лоскутность опубликования которых фиксируется с 2022 г. в разрезе субъектов РФ по экспортно-импортным операциям.</p></abstract><kwd-group xml:lang="en"><kwd>sanctions pressure</kwd><kwd>critical imports</kwd><kwd>international supply chains</kwd><kwd>transformation of foreign markets</kwd><kwd>transnational logistical gaps</kwd><kwd>import vulnerability of regions</kwd><kwd>panel data analysis</kwd></kwd-group><kwd-group xml:lang="ru"><kwd>санкционное давление</kwd><kwd>критический импорт</kwd><kwd>международные цепи поставок (МЦП)</kwd><kwd>трансформация внешних рынков</kwd><kwd>транснациональные логистические разрывы</kwd><kwd>импортоуязвимость регионов</kwd><kwd>анализ панельных данных</kwd></kwd-group></article-meta></front><body/><back><ack xml:lang="en"><p>The study was funded by a subsidy allocated to Kazan Federal University to support the implementation of a state-funded research project (No. FZSM–2023–0017), “The Economics of Regional Import Substitution amid Logistics Chain Transformation and Deglobalization.”</p></ack><ack xml:lang="ru"><p>Работа выполнена за счет средств субсидии, выделенной Казанскому федеральному университету для выполнения государственного задания в сфере научной деятельности по проекту № FZSM — 2023 — 0017 «Экономика импортозамещения региона в условиях трансформации логистических цепочек и деглобализации».</p></ack><ref-list><ref id="en-ref1"><label>1</label><mixed-citation xml:lang="en">Abdulla, A.
